[0001] This utility model relates to the field of LED driver circuit technology, specifically to a multi-channel LED constant current driver circuit with low temperature drift and temperature compensation function. Background Technology
[0002] To ensure constant brightness and prevent brightness fluctuations due to input voltage variations, LEDs are typically driven using constant current circuits. Among the various constant current circuits available, transistor-based constant current circuits are highly favored due to their low cost, simple circuitry, and wide range of brand options.
[0003] Please refer to Chinese utility model patent CN210807724U, which discloses four types of LED constant current control circuits, and the problems are as follows:
[0004] Please refer to the appendix to the instruction manual with publication number CN210807724U. Figure 1 The first calculation doesn't consider fluctuations in the LED's input voltage (i.e., the LED's anode). This means the current flowing through the LED will still vary significantly, resulting in large deviations in the LED's brightness. Brightness increases with higher voltage and decreases with lower voltage. Furthermore, it doesn't account for changes in the transistor's Vbe voltage. Because the control power supply voltage remains constant, the resistance values of resistors R1 and R2 change minimally with temperature, and Vb can be considered a constant voltage. led = (Vb - Vbe) / R3, where Vb and R3 remain constant. When the circuit is working normally, the junction temperature of the transistor gradually increases, and Vbe will increase with the increase of the junction temperature. Therefore, Ve and I... led The value will gradually decrease as the junction temperature of the transistor increases.
[0005] Please refer to the appendix to the instruction manual with publication number CN210807724U. Figure 2 I led =(Vcc-Vled) / (R3+RDSON)≈(Vcc-VLED) / R3, the constant current accuracy is relatively low.
[0006] Please refer to the appendix to the instruction manual with publication number CN210807724U. Figure 3 I led ≈(Vb+Txη-Vbe) / R3, where η is the temperature drift coefficient, and Vb is controlled by the Zener diode, resulting in significant temperature drift.
[0007] Please refer to Figure 4, I of the specification with publication number CN210807724U. led ≈Vbe / R3, severe temperature drift, relatively expensive.
[0008] In general, most existing LED constant current drive circuits based on transistors suffer from problems such as LED brightness varying with voltage fluctuations, and significant temperature drift due to the decrease in transistor Vbe with increasing temperature. led The problem of reduction. [0030] The temperature compensation circuit 4 includes an NTC thermistor R9, a transistor Q8, and a resistor R16. One end of the NTC thermistor R9 is connected to the common terminal of the base of transistor Q8 via a resistor R10, and then connected to voltage input terminal 1. The other end of the NTC thermistor R9 is grounded. The emitter of transistor Q8 is connected to the ground via a resistor R16, and the collector of transistor Q8 is connected to the base of all transistors Q4. Specifically, the common terminal of the collector of transistor Q8 and the negative terminal of the three-terminal adjustable shunt regulator D1 is connected to voltage input terminal 1 via a resistor R4. The base of each transistor Q4 is connected to the negative terminal of the three-terminal adjustable shunt regulator D1 and the common terminal of the collector of transistor Q8 and resistor R4.
[0031] Therefore, the temperature compensation circuit 4 consists of a drive resistor R10, an NTC thermistor R9, a transistor Q8, and a resistor R16 that controls the degree of current attenuation. Furthermore, the NTC thermistor R9 is located near the heat source of the low-temperature drift multi-channel LED constant current drive circuit, which is composed of all the transistors.
[0032] When the circuit board temperature is low, the NTC thermistor R9 has a large resistance, the base-emitter junction of transistor Q8 is open, and the base current of each transistor Q4 will decrease to varying degrees depending on the resistance of resistor R16. The larger the resistance R16, the larger the base current of transistor Q4, and the greater the current I of LED load 2. led The larger the value, the smaller the resistor R16, the smaller the base current of transistor Q4, and the smaller the current I of LED load 2. led The smaller the value, the lower the voltage drop across the NTC thermistor R9. As the temperature rises, the voltage drop across the base-beam (BE) junction of transistor Q8 becomes less than the turn-on voltage of Q8, causing Q8 to turn off. At this time, the current I of LED load 2... led Obtain the set maximum current value and keep it stable.
[0033] The collectors of each transistor Q4 are connected to the negative terminal of the corresponding LED load 2. The emitter of one transistor Q4 is connected to one end of the corresponding current-limiting resistor unit and the reference voltage terminal of the three-terminal adjustable shunt regulator D1. The bases of each transistor Q4 are connected to the common terminal of the driving resistor R4 and the negative terminal of the three-terminal adjustable shunt regulator D1. The positive terminal of the three-terminal adjustable shunt regulator D1 is grounded. Therefore, the constant current I of the LED load 2... led =V REF / R 限流 , where V REF R represents the reference voltage at the reference voltage terminal of the three-terminal adjustable shunt regulator D1. 限流 This indicates the total resistance value of the current-limiting resistor unit. The constant current accuracy is limited by the selection of the current-limiting resistor.
[0034] Therefore, by applying the above constant current circuit, the reference voltage of the reference voltage terminal of the three-terminal adjustable shunt regulator D1 is either 1.25V or 2.5V, and the accuracy is extremely high. It is not affected by the input voltage and temperature. Therefore, with this design, a constant current output can still be obtained when the voltage and temperature change.
[0035] Please see Figure 3 The low-temperature drift multi-channel LED constant current drive circuit with temperature compensation function also includes a one-to-all-out circuit. The LED load 2 is provided with two sets. The one-to-all-out circuit is provided with a common cathode fast recovery diode Q12, MOSFET Q2, MOSFET Q3, resistor R5, resistor R6, resistor R7, resistor R8 and capacitor C7.
[0036] The common cathode of the common cathode fast recovery diode Q12 is connected to the base of transistor Q7. The collector of transistor Q7 is connected to the negative terminal of the three-terminal adjustable shunt regulator D1. The collector of transistor Q8 is connected to the common terminal of the bases of all transistors Q4. This collector is also connected in series with capacitor C7 and then grounded. The emitter of transistor Q7 is grounded. The two anodes of the common cathode fast recovery diode Q12 are connected to the drains of MOSFETs Q2 and Q3, respectively. One anode of the common cathode fast recovery diode Q12 connected to the drain of MOSFET Q2 is also... A series resistor R6 is connected to voltage input terminal 1. The common-cathode fast recovery diode Q12 is connected to one anode of the drain of MOSFET Q3, and another series resistor R5 is connected to voltage input terminal 1. The gate of MOSFET Q2 is connected to the common terminal of the negative terminal of one LED load 2 and the collector of the corresponding transistor Q4, after a series resistor R8. The gate of MOSFET Q3 is connected to the common terminal of the negative terminal of the other LED load 2 and the collector of the corresponding transistor Q4, after a series resistor R7. The sources of both MOSFETs Q2 and Q3 are grounded. The common-cathode fast recovery diode Q12 is used as an OR gate.
[0037] When both LED loads 2 are working normally, the voltages of TP7 and TP10 are approximately equal, the source of MOSFET Q3 is grounded, and when the gate voltage is high, the VGS of MOSFET Q3 is greater than or equal to 0, MOSFET Q3 is turned on, and the current flowing through resistor R5 is all conducted to ground through the N-body diode of MOSFET Q3. The common cathode fast recovery diode Q12 is not working at all, and the circuit is operating normally.
[0038] When LED1 in one of the LED loads 2 corresponding to MOSFET Q3 is open-circuited, the voltage of TP7 will drop to near 0V, and the voltage of TP10, which is approximately the same as the voltage of TP7, will also drop to 0V. MOSFET Q3 will then be turned off, and the current will no longer flow through MOSFET Q3 but will instead flow to the common cathode fast recovery diode Q12. With the common cathode fast recovery diode Q12 conducting, the base of transistor Q7 will be at a high level, and transistor Q7 will be turned on. The base current of transistor Q4 and all parallel driving transistors will then flow to ground through transistor Q7, causing all transistors Q4 in both LED loads 2 to malfunction.
[0039] The same principle applies to the Q2 side of the MOSFET. If even one LED1 on the circuit board is open, all LED1s in the entire circuit will be turned off. This achieves the function of turning off all LEDs if one is open.
